Opendoor's Top Leadership & Management Strengths

Strategic Vision & Planning: Leaders have articulated a “Velocity OS” strategy that prioritizes faster inventory turns, disciplined margins, and partner‑led, asset‑light distribution. They are also layering owned services (mortgage, escrow) to improve attach and unit economics.

Purposeful Goal Setting: Management has set explicit, time‑bound financial markers, including adjusted‑EBITDA profitability on a forward‑12‑month basis starting in Q2 2026 and adjusted net‑income breakeven by year‑end 2026. Near‑term guidance calls out sequential revenue growth, a targeted contribution‑margin band, and quarterly adjusted‑EBITDA breakeven.

Open & Transparent Communication: Leadership has increased transparency with a public “Financial Open House” cadence and a live tracker for acquisition contracts, inviting stakeholders to monitor progress. Public partner hubs and builder tie‑ups make the distribution strategy visible in market rather than theoretical.

Metropolis Technologies's Top Leadership & Management Strengths

Strategic Vision & Planning: Leadership consistently articulates a clear North Star around building an AI “recognition” layer for the physical world beyond parking, with messaging that remains stable across CEO essays and company materials. External coverage mirrors this framing, indicating a coherent and durable thesis.

Decisive Leadership: Major moves—taking SP+ private and acquiring Oosto—directly reinforce the recognition‑first strategy by pairing operating scale with core computer‑vision capability. The 2025 financing was positioned to accelerate expansion across parking, retail, hospitality, fueling, and mobility, reflecting timely decisions aligned to strategy.

Resource Support: Capital raises and acquisitions are described as fuel and capability build‑outs to execute the plan across thousands of locations and new verticals. Feedback suggests resources have been marshaled in step with the stated direction, translating strategy into footprint and payments‑volume scale.
